Identifying Iron Bacteria in Your Water Supply
Are you noticing persistent reddish-brown stains on your porcelain sinks or a metallic taste in your drinking water? These tell-tale signs may indicate the presence of iron bacteria in your water supply. This issue, while not necessarily harmful in small amounts, can lead to unpleasant water quality and potential plumbing damage. Homeowners often find that this bacteria can form a slimy layer in plumbing systems and water treatment equipment, complicating water filtration processes.
Confirming the Presence of Iron Bacteria
Before taking any action, it’s critical to confirm the presence of iron bacteria in your water. A simple water test can provide valuable insights. Look for home testing kits specifically designed for iron and other contaminants, which are available at local retailers or online. Although lab testing offers more comprehensive analysis, a quick at-home test can help you determine whether additional steps are needed.
How Iron Bacteria Affects Your Water
- Staining: A noticeable reddish-brown color on fixtures and laundry.
- Unpleasant Taste: A metallic flavor that may deter you from using tap water.
- Odor: A musty or swampy smell can indicate the presence of organic material associated with iron bacteria.
- Clogged Plumbing: Bacteria can create slime, leading to potential blockages in your pipes.
Treatment Solutions for Iron Bacteria
When it comes to treating iron bacteria, iron removal systems are a popular choice among homeowners. These systems utilize various technologies, such as oxidation, filtration, and ion exchange, to effectively remove iron and its associated bacteria from your water supply.
Understanding Iron Removal Technology
Iron removal systems typically work by oxidizing soluble iron into solid particles, which can then be filtered out of the water. Depending on your system, the best approach may involve a combination of chemical treatment and mechanical filtration. This ensures that both the iron and any bacteria present are effectively eliminated, providing cleaner and clearer water.
Sizing Your Iron Removal System
Proper sizing is essential for an effective iron removal system. Homeowners should consider the following factors:
- Flow Rate: Assess your household's peak water usage to determine the required flow rate for the system.
- Grain Capacity: Calculate the total grain removal needed based on water quality and usage to prevent frequent regeneration cycles.
- Gallons Per Day (GPD): Understand your daily water consumption to ensure the system can handle your needs effectively.
- Tank Size: Choose an appropriately sized tank to contain the filtration media while allowing for optimal performance.
Maintenance Requirements for Iron Removal Systems
To keep your iron removal system functioning effectively, regular maintenance is key. Homeowners should monitor the system and perform maintenance tasks such as:
- Media Replacement: Depending on the type of media used, replacement may be required every few years.
- System Cleaning: Regularly clean tank components to prevent buildup and maintain efficiency.
- Monitoring Performance: Keep an eye on water quality and system pressure, adjusting as necessary.

Alternative Treatment Methods
Besides traditional iron removal systems, there are alternative methods to manage iron bacteria in water supply systems:
- Chlorination: This method involves introducing chlorine into the water supply, effectively killing bacteria and reducing iron levels.
- Ultraviolet (UV) Light Treatment: UV systems can disinfect water without the use of chemicals, effectively neutralizing iron bacteria.
- Oxidation Filtration: Using oxidizing agents, this process converts dissolved iron into solid particles that can be filtered out.
